On 21/3/22 16:09, Russell Coker wrote: > Also I'm using Wayland on a Librem5, that's supposed to work the same way as X > for such things isn't it? From what I read, under Wayland, xkbcomp to the display will only affect the XWayland proxy and so only the X11 applications which use it. I don't have any experience with how keyboard configuration is done in Wayland proper.
